Validity 1 Validity This update is valid for the following products: STEP 7 Basic V14 SP1 STEP 7 Professional V14 SP1 WinCC Basic V14 SP1 WinCC Comfort V14 SP1 WinCC Advanced V14 SP1 WinCC Professional V14 SP1 Note If you modify your system after installing the update with the product DVD, you will have to perform the update again., 05/2017 5

Improvements in STEP 7 2 2.1 Improvements in Update 1 Update 1 contains the following improvements and changes: Working with the TIA Portal Stability when working with the TIA Portal has been improved, partly based on the feedback from returned crash reports. Use of the instructions SCATTER and GATHER The instructions SCATTER and GATHER can be used on an S7-1500 CPU starting with FW V2.1 and on an S7-1200 CPU as of FW >V4.2. Total size of the associated values for program messages The alarm procedure of the S7-1500 CPU allows a maximum of 512 bytes for associated values (SD parameters) of the instruction "Program_Alarm". You will only see a warning regarding this number in the TIA Portal <= V14 during compilation. There is a stricter check as of TIA Portal V14 SP1 and later. When this number is exceeded, an error is already output during compilation to exclude error scenarios during runtime. This check from now on no longer refers to the actual size of the SD parameters at the time the instruction "Program_Alarm" is called, but to the maximum possible size of the SD parameters. This means you must decide beforehand with what length you declare the character string tags you are transferring, because these take up a large number of bytes. This must be taken into account during migration of projects from version <= V14 to version V14 SP1 Update 1. Parameter type "Block_DB" for entry of the instance DB In LAD and FBD, you cannot enter the instance DB of an instruction using an input of the data type "Block_DB". This behavior has been made uniform for all CPU families and all block types. As of TIA Portal V14 SP1 Update 1, a compilation error is output. If you have transferred instance DBs in your program with the help of the "Block_DB" data type, you must change your program. Instead use a parameter instance to transfer the instance during runtime. Instruction "GetSMCinfo: Reading out information about the SIMATIC memory card" Contrary to the description in the online help, a diagnostics interrupt is not generated in mode = 3 if the configured part of the service life in % has expired., 05/2017 7
Improvements in STEP 7 2.1 Improvements in Update 1 Copying ARRAY elements As of TIA Portal Version V14 SP1 Update 1, the comments are also taken into consideration when copying ARRAYs from one TIA Portal project to another TIA Portal project. Display of actual values during block call When monitoring the output tags of a block, the actual values of the formal operand are once again displayed during the block call as was the case up to TIA Portal version V13 SP1. Instructions "(U)MOVE_BLK" und "(U)FILL_BLK" for S7-1500 The instructions "(U)MOVE_BLK" and "(U)FILL_BLK" only accessed the process image in TIA Portal <= V14 SP1 when directly accessing the I/O. This behavior has been corrected and now causes a runtime error because direct I/O access is not permitted for BLK instructions. Daylight saving time in the alarm display If alarms from CPUs of the S7-1200 and S7-1500 series are displayed in the alarm display of the TIA Portal, daylight saving time has not been taken into account in the "Time" column so far. As of TIA Portal V14 SP1 Update 1, daylight saving time is taken into account. Local ProDiag supervision alarms for multi-instances When a supervised program block was called multiple times as multi-instance, the preconnected operand of the first call in the alarm text has been displayed until now even if, for example, the third multi-instance showed a fault. As of TIA Portal V14 SP1 Update 1, it is always the correct pre-connected operand that is displayed. Detection of modifications to program blocks which are created as types in the library When new type versions of blocks are released in the library, the blocks used are checked for changes to the interface (e.g. by the modification of the version of an instruction). If changes are detected, the blocks used also have to be re-released. Diagnostics event "Temporary CPU error (S7-1500/S7-1200 as of V4)" The following sporadic message: "Serious firmware exception (not relevant for user, system code: 16#00400001, 16#10020065, 16#72A15A70)" no longer occurs during a complex program flow (e.g. large loops or jumps) with simultaneous multiple data block or structure accesses inside and outside of loops. Monitoring branched power paths in LAD networks The display of branched power paths in LAD during monitoring has been improved. 8, 05/2017
Improvements in STEP 7 2.1 Improvements in Update 1 Exporting objects with Openness Stability has been improved during export with Openness. A successful export is now also possible if e.g. the version of the export object has been deleted., 05/2017 9

Improvements in WinCC 3 3.1 Panels 3.1.1 Improvements in Update 1 Update 1 contains the following improvements and changes: DHCP on KTP 400 PN, KTP 700 PN and KTP 900 PN Operation with DHCP is possible without any restrictions for the KTP 400 PN, KTP 700 PN and KTP 900 PN devices. 3.2 Runtime Advanced 3.2.1 Improvements in Update 1 Update 1 contains the following improvements and changes: Screens and screen objects in Runtime The function of the object "ProDiag overview" has been improved. 3.3 Runtime Professional 3.3.1 Improvements in Update 1 Update 1 contains the following improvements and changes: Screens and screen objects in Runtime The function of the object "ProDiag overview" has been improved. The function of the object "Media Player" has been improved., 05/2017 11
